如何在SQL Server 2005中更新视图

时间:2013-09-19 13:35:56

标签: sql sql-server-2005

我想在不删除现有视图的情况下更新现有视图,您能否只提供语法怎么做??

现有观点:

CREATE VIEW V1 AS SELECT EMP_ID,NAME FROM EMP_TABLE

我想将V1更新为:

SELECT EMP_ID,NAME, SALARY WHERE SALARY>10000

2 个答案:

答案 0 :(得分:5)

这很简单:

ALTER VIEW V1 AS
  SELECT EMP_ID,NAME, SALARY WHERE SALARY > 10000;

答案 1 :(得分:1)

如果您将来忘记了这一点,您可以随时右键单击SQL Server Management Studio中的视图并选择“修改”,这将为您提供当前查询,并使用正确的语法进行更改。